FOI requests take time

Those who have doubts whether the federal Freedom of Information Act needs some fine tuning need only to read this New York Times piece about how long some people have waited to have their requests answered. The delays have taken up to 20 years.

SPJ has lobbied on behalf of the new FOI bill.
